∫ Attaching to a wall<br />

1 Drive a screw (not included) into a wall.<br />

2 Fit the speaker securely onto the screw(s) with the hole(s).<br />

≥The wall or pillar on which the speakers are to be attached should be capable of<br />

Wall or pillar<br />

supporting 10 kg per screw. Consult a qualified building contractor when attaching the<br />

speakers to a wall. Improper attachment may result in damage to the wall and<br />

speakers.<br />

∫ Fitting speaker stands (not included)<br />

[HT878] [<strong>HT870</strong>] (Center speaker only)[HT520]<br />

Ensure the stands meet these conditions before purchasing them.<br />

Observe the diameter and length of the screws and the distance between screws as shown in the diagram.<br />

≥The stands must be able to support over 10 kg.<br />

≥The stands must be stable even if the speakers are in a high position.<br />
